tema klasorunun içinde cokizlenenler.php adında dosyam var sitedede çok izlenenler bölümü var fakat bu bölümde videoları listelemek yerine
{cokizlenenler} şeklinde çıkartıyor bu konu hakkında yardıma ihtiyacım var
cokizlenenler.php ile cokizlenenler.tpl arasında bağlantımı kuramıyor anlamadım ekrana {cokizlenenler} şeklinde basıyor
cokizlenenler.php
<?php
if( ! defined( 'DATALIFEENGINE' ) ) {
die( "Akilli ol ***!" );
}
$is_change = false;
if ($config['allow_cache'] != "yes") { $config['allow_cache'] = "yes"; $is_change = true;}
$tpl->result['cokizlenenler'] = dle_cache("cokizlenenler", $config['skin']);
$tpl->load_template( 'cokizlenenler.tpl' );
if( strpos( $tpl->copy_template, "[xfvalue_" ) !== false ) { $xfound = true; $xfields = xfieldsload();}
else $xfound = false;
if ($tpl->result['cokizlenenler'] === false) {
$sql = $db->query( "SELECT id, title, date, alt_name, news_read, comm_num, category,xfields,autor FROM " . PREFIX . "_post ORDER BY news_read DESC LIMIT 0,3" );
while ($row = $db->get_row($sql))
{
$sql2 = $db->query( "SELECT alt_name FROM " . PREFIX . "_category WHERE id='$row[category]'" );
$row2 = $db->get_row($sql2);
if( $xfound ) {
$xfieldsdata = xfieldsdataload( $row['xfields'] );
foreach ( $xfields as $value ) {
$preg_safe_name = preg_quote( $value[0], "'" );
if( empty( $xfieldsdata[$value[0]] ) ) {
$tpl->copy_template = preg_replace( "'\\[xfgiven_{$preg_safe_name}\\](.*?)\\[/xfgiven_{$preg_safe_name}\\]'is", "", $tpl->copy_template );
} else {
$tpl->copy_template = preg_replace( "'\\[xfgiven_{$preg_safe_name}\\](.*?)\\[/xfgiven_{$preg_safe_name}\\]'is", "\\1", $tpl->copy_template );
}
$tpl->copy_template = str_replace( "[xfvalue_{$preg_safe_name}]", stripslashes( $xfieldsdata[$value[0]] ), $tpl->copy_template );
}
}
if($config['seo_type']=='1')
{
$link= "$row[id]".'-'."$row[alt_name]".'.html';
}
else
{
$link="$row2[alt_name]".'/'."$row[id]".'-'."$row[alt_name]".'.html';
}
$tpl->set( '{baslik}',stripslashes($row['title']));
$tpl->set( '{yazar}', stripslashes($row['autor']));
$tpl->set( '{tarih}', $row['date']);
$tpl->set( '{izlenme}', $row['news_read']);
$tpl->set( '{yorum}', $row['comm_num']);
$tpl->set( '{link}',$link);
$tpl->compile('cokizlenenler');
}
create_cache ("cokizlenenler", $tpl->result['cokizlenenler'], $config['skin']);
$tpl->clear();
$db->free();
}
if ($is_change) $config['allow_cache'] = false;
?>
cokizlenenler.tpl dosyası
<div class="tab-content clearfix">
<div class="tab-thumb"><a href="{link}" title="{baslik}"><img title="{baslik}" src="[xfvalue_resim]" alt="{baslik}" style="border-width: 0px; height: 63px; width: 71px;" /></a></div><!--[if !IE]>tab-thumb<![endif]-->
<div class="tab-text">
<h1><a href="{link}"><b>{baslik}</b><br></a></h1>
<p><b>Tarih : </b>{tarih}<br></p>
<p><b>İzlenme : </font></b>{izlenme}<br></p>
<p><b>Yorumlar : </b>{yorum} Yorum var</p>
</div><!--[if !IE]>tab-text<![endif]-->
</div><!--[if !IE]>tab-content<![endif]-->